A recruitment agency is searching for a Project Engineer to manage CAPEX projects in a food and beverage company in Nottingham. The role demands the oversight of projects while ensuring compliance with health and safety standards.
The candidate will handle budget management, communicate project objectives, and lead a team for efficient project execution. Experience in the FMCG sector and project management is essential for this mid-senior level position.
